Blue Tuesday

Claude Gidson, Blue Tuesday DirectorThe vision of Blue Tuesday is to provide a unique, memorable, chic, upbeat environment for like-minded urban professionals that are either friends or associates of the men of Iota Nu Sigma chapter to network and socialize with.  All of the venues selected provide their own unique experience in contemporary settings, which are easily accessible with ample parking.  If image is everything then the venues selected will speak volumes about the men of Iota Nu Sigma Chapter.Past host venues includet Nacional 27, Sullivan’s Steakhouse, Devon Seafood, Martini Park, Vintage Wine Bar, Boundary Tavern and Grill, Crimson Lounge, and Landmark Grill, Red Kiva, Sawtooth, and Ghostbar.

The goal of Blue Tuesday is to provide a win-win situation for the fraternity and the venue.  By bringing in an established clientele of urban professionals to meet, greet and network to your venue on an off-peak night will generate traffic and exposure for you.  Iota Nu Sigma will continue to establish a brand/image of urban professionals with an edge of sexy, upscale and excellence.  We feature a special happy hour drink at each event and also promote host venues on our website as a friend of Iota Nu Sigma.
 

About the Director

Brother Claude Gibson currently serves at the director of Blu Tuesday for INS.  Inducted in April of 1991 at the Epsilon Xi chapter of Phi Beta Sigma located at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ign, he has been active at both the undergraduate and alumni level.  Born and raised on the south side of Chicago, he attended Hirsch Metro High School and earned his Bachelor of Arts degree from U of I in 1995.

He was there when Iota Nu Sigma was reactivated in 2000 serving as the first director of Blu Tuesday at it’s inception in 2001 as well as fundraising chair, member of the Bigger and Better Business committee, and contributing as a writer to The Sentinel.  Bro. Gibson has seen the chapter experience tremendous growth over the past ten years.  His vision for Blu Tuesday is to see the event continue to grow into a dynamic marketing opportunity for the chapter and develop “Next Level” events and programming that guests enjoy and continue to talk about.

Professionally, Bro. Gibson has worked on the sales side of the group benefits and insurance industry for the past 15 years.  He has worked in all lines of the business selling to and working with companies both large and small. Bro. Gibson has also been involved in the television and film industry as he has cast for films and television shows.

Bro. Gibson continues to work to help improve and strengthen Iota Nu Sigma’s presence in the Chicagoland area and its’ presence in the fraternity.  He looks forward to very big things from INS over the second decade of the Iota Nu Sigma re-incarnation.
